Datalogic S300-PR-1-C06-RX Diffuse Proximity Sensor
Datalogic S300PR1C06RX Diffuse Photoelectric Proximity Sensor
The **Datalogic S300PR1C06RX Diffuse Photoelectric Proximity Sensor** is designed for precise detection with a **0.05 to 5 m operating distance**. It features a **diffused proximity optic function**, providing reliable sensing for various applications. The sensor uses an **IR LED (880 nm)** for light emission, ensuring high sensitivity and stable performance. It supports a **wide power supply range** of **24 to 240 V AC** or **24 to 60 V DC**, making it versatile for different systems. The sensor comes with a **sensitivity trimmer** and a **DARK/LIGHT trimmer** for easy setup and adjustment. It features a **relay output** with a maximum output current of **3 A**, and a **switching frequency** of up to **25 Hz**. The sensor is housed in **PBT material** and offers an **IP67 protection degree**, ensuring durability in harsh environments. Designed to operate in temperatures ranging from **-40 to +55 °C**, the sensor is ideal for use in industrial and outdoor applications. The **dimensions** of **25 x 100 x 70 mm** make it compact and easy to integrate into a variety of setups.

| Optic Function | Diffused Proximity |
| Operating Distance | 0.05 to 5 m |
| Response Time | 20 ms max |
| Power Supply | 24 to 240 V AC / 24 to 60 V DC |
| Setting | Sensitivity trimmer, DARK/LIGHT trimmer |
| Power Consumption | 3 VA max |
| Light Emission | IR LED 880 nm |
| Output Type | Relay |
| Output Current | 3 A max |
| Switching Frequency | 25 Hz max |
| Connection | Terminal block, M12 4-pole connector |
| Protection Degree | IP67 |
| Housing Material | PBT |
| Operating Temperature | -40 to +55 °C |
| Dimensions | 25 x 100 x 70 mm |
